PMD Results
The following document contains the results of PMD 5.3.2.
Files
org/apache/maven/shared/release/DefaultReleaseManager.java
Violation |
Line |
Avoid unused private fields such as 'scmRepositoryConfigurator'. |
90 |
org/apache/maven/shared/release/config/PropertiesReleaseDescriptorStore.java
Violation |
Line |
Useless parentheses. |
294 |
Useless parentheses. |
295 |
org/apache/maven/shared/release/exec/MavenExecutorException.java
Violation |
Line |
Avoid unused private fields such as 'stdErr'. |
30 |
Avoid unused private fields such as 'stdOut'. |
32 |
org/apache/maven/shared/release/exec/TeeOutputStream.java
Violation |
Line |
Useless parentheses. |
54 |
Useless parentheses. |
72 |
org/apache/maven/shared/release/phase/AbstractRewritePomsPhase.java
Violation |
Line |
Useless parentheses. |
364 |
Avoid empty if statements |
598–600 |
Avoid empty if statements |
609–611 |
Useless parentheses. |
862 |
Useless parentheses. |
862 |
org/apache/maven/shared/release/phase/CheckDependencySnapshotsPhase.java
Violation |
Line |
These nested if statements could be combined |
129–132 |
org/apache/maven/shared/release/phase/GenerateReleasePomsPhase.java
Violation |
Line |
Avoid unused method parameters such as 'simulate'. |
139 |
Avoid unused method parameters such as 'version'. |
337 |
org/apache/maven/shared/release/phase/MapVersionsPhase.java
Violation |
Line |
Avoid unused method parameters such as 'result'. |
201 |
org/apache/maven/shared/release/phase/RunPerformGoalsPhase.java
Violation |
Line |
Avoid unused method parameters such as 'reactorProjects'. |
50 |
org/apache/maven/shared/release/phase/ScmCommitPreparationPhase.java
Violation |
Line |
Avoid unused private methods such as 'createRollbackMessage(ReleaseDescriptor)'. |
81 |